The Fatih Mosque is a mosque in Tirilye, Bursa Province, Turkey. The structure was originally constructed in the 8th or 9th as a Byzantine church and was later converted to a Muslim place of worship during the 16th century. It again served as a Greek Orthodox church between 1920 and 1922 until it was re-converted to a mosque in 1923.
